Paris, New York Demographics

The total population of Paris town is estimated to be 4,315 with 2,251 males (52.17%) and 2,064 females (47.83%). There are 187 less females than males in Paris town.
The median household income in Paris town was $90,287 in 2021, which marked an an increase of 1,452(1.63%) from $88,835 in 2020. This income is 121.02% of the U.S. median household income of $74,606 (all incomes in 2022 inflation-adjusted dollars).
Per the latest American Community Survey by the Census Bureau, Paris town sees its highest median household income among householders in the age group of 25 to 44 years old, at $127,735. Overall, the median household income for the town of Paris town stands at $90,287.
In Paris town, the median income for all workers aged 15 years and older, regardless of work hours, was $59,600 for males and $34,966 for females. However, when specifically considering full-time, year-round workers within the same age group, the median income was $83,885 for males and $65,618 for females.
In Paris town, there are just two different racial groups among households. Among these, White households report a median household income of $92,536, while Two or More Races households have a median household income of $84,139.
In 2022, the population of Paris town was 4,248, a 0.98% decrease year-by-year from 2021. Previously, in 2021, Paris town's population was 4,290, a decline of 0.83% compared to a population of 4,326 in 2020.
The median age in Paris, New York is 43.2, as per 2021 ACS 5-Year Estimates. Of the total population, 19.17% were under the age of 15, 15.04% aged 15 to 29, 48.97% aged 30 to 64, 16.43% aged 65 to 84, and 0.39% were 85 years of age and older.
Racial distribution of Paris town population: 95.97% are White, 0.53% are Black or African American, 1.78% are Asian and 1.71% are multiracial.
